Sistem Kontrol DDC Cleanroom

A distributed direct-digital-control panel that manages cleanroom HVAC loops, schedules and alarms through networked BACnet room and plant controllers.

Perkenalan produk

DDC controllers are distributed between AHUs, mechanical rooms and cleanroom zones so each group of HVAC points is controlled close to the equipment. Universal inputs accept common temperature, humidity and pressure signals, while analog and digital outputs command dampers, valves and fan drives. BACnet communication exposes live values, alarms, schedules and trends to the building-management platform. Local programs and retained configuration allow the controlled plant to continue operating during a supervisory-network interruption.

Kekhawatiran produk pelanggan

A DDC system must distribute control efficiently while preserving a consistent point structure and dependable communication to the central BMS.

Long home-run cables increase installation complexity and analog noise.Local DDC panels position I/O near AHUs and cleanroom zone equipment.
Different controller programs use inconsistent point names.A standardized device and point naming structure keeps graphics, alarms and trends aligned.
Supervisory network loss interrupts basic plant sequences.Local DDC logic, schedules and retained setpoints continue at the controller level.
Adding one sensor consumes a dedicated fixed-function module.Configurable universal I/O channels accommodate several common signal types.
